Cable Type
The PROFIBUS standard EN 50170 specifies Type A shielded, twisted- pair
cable as the recommended cable type for use in an RS-485 based PROFI-
BUS network. This cable type has the following characteristics:
Note The PROFIBUS standard EN 50170 also specifies a Type B cable with slightly
different cable characteristics. This Type B cable is no longer recommended
for use.
Maximum PROFIBUS
Cable Length
The transmission speed defines the maximum advised cable distance or
cable segment in metres before the use of a repeater is recommended. The
cable lengths specified in the following table are based on PROFIBUS type A
cable.
